Meet the Daffodil Runner: A poignant reminder of the UKs end-of-life care crisis. As runners prepare for the TCS London Marathon, theyll encounter a life-size figure adorned with 557 steel daffodils, each symbolizing a person who dies daily without proper care. Dr. Sarah Holmes, Marie Curies chief medical officer, highlights the urgent need for better support, revealing that nearly one in three Brits miss out on needed end-of-life care. The charity aims to raise two million pounds through marathon runners to continue providing community care and hospice support.
